Lula Extends R$ 30 Bi Credit for Application Drivers

Summary by Tribuna Online
Luiz Inácio Lula da Silva (PT) sanctioned the bill on the afternoon of Monday. Photo: Ricardo Stuckert / PR President Luiz Inácio Lula da Silva (PT) sanctioned on the afternoon of Monday (14) the bill that extends the program Move Brazil Taxi and Applications, with R$ 30 billion in subsidized credit for acquisition of new and semi-new vehicles by taxi drivers, application and school transportation.Created by interim measure in May, the program w…

President Luiz Inácio Lula da Silva sanctioned, on Monday (14), the law establishing lines of credit in the Move Brazil program for new vehicles. The program enables the financing of cars and motorcycles, aimed at taxi drivers, application drivers, delivery agents and motoapps and becomes permanent.
